UTV Crash Takes Life Of 18 Year-Old Man In Stanley County

FORT PIERRE, (KCCR) — The Stanley County Sheriff’s Office says an 18 year-old man died last weekend in a U-T-V crash. Sheriff Brad Rathbun says 18 year-old Hayden Monson died at the scene. Monson was one of four males using the U-T-V at the time. The others involved are 18, 19 and 20 years-old. The crash was reported around 1:45 am Saturday, but the reporting party couldn’t give responders an accurate location. The scene was discovered around 3:25 am. Two of the men were transported to Avera St. Mary’s hospital in Pierre. One was flown to Avera McKennen hospital in Sioux Falls in critical condition. The third male was transported by private vehicle and released. Assisting Stanley County Law Enforcement at the scene were units from Fort Pierre Fire, Pierre Rescue and A-M-R Ambulance. The incident happened about a mile west of Fort Pierre.
